Factors Affecting Cost
- Soil Type: Different soil types require varying levels of preparation and equipment, impacting the overall cost.
- Project Size: Larger projects typically require more materials and labor, increasing the total expense.
- Accessibility: Sites that are difficult to access may require specialized equipment or additional labor, raising costs.
- Material Quality: Higher quality backfill materials can be more expensive but may offer better durability and performance.
- Labor Rates: Local labor rates in Lafayette, IN can affect the cost, with more experienced workers commanding higher wages.
- Permits and Regulations: Compliance with local building codes and obtaining necessary permits can add to the overall cost.
- Equipment Rental: The need for specialized equipment, which may need to be rented, can also influence the total expense.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Lafayette, IN) |
---|---|
Basic Backfill Installation | $1,200 - $2,500 |
Excavation and Grading | $500 - $1,500 |
Soil Testing and Analysis | $200 - $500 |
Material Delivery | $100 - $300 |
Compaction and Leveling | $300 - $800 |
Drainage Installation | $800 - $2,000 |
Permit Fees | $50 - $200 |
